Working with Images in Macromedia Fireworks MX
Overview/Description
To discuss how to work with images in Fireworks MX
Target Audience
Web designers; graphic designers; home users and end users with an interest in graphic design; Macromedia Dreamweaver MX users and Macromedia Flash MX developers using Macromedia Fireworks MX to create graphics
Prerequisites
A basic understanding of image editing; familiarity with web terminology; experience working in a Microsoft Windows or Apple Macintosh environment
Expected Duration
260 Minutes
Objectives:
Working with Images in Macromedia Fireworks MX
discuss the capabilities and navigation features of the Fireworks MX interface.
open an existing document in Fireworks MX and navigate the Fireworks MX interface.
explain how to create a new document in Fireworks MX.
describe how use selection tools and modify bitmap images in Fireworks MX.
create and edit bitmap graphics in Fireworks MX.
describe how to create layers and work with vector objects in Fireworks MX.
explain how to use freeform vector tools and layers in Fireworks MX.
show how to combine simple paths into complex objects in Fireworks MX using the Union, Intersect, Punch, and Crop commands.
combine vector paths in Fireworks MX.
explain how to use stroke and fill options when editing or creating an image in Fireworks MX.
describe how to create and apply effects, styles, and blending to a Fireworks MX document.
outline how to create and use masks effectively in Fireworks MX.
create a mask in Fireworks MX.
